In many facilities, lighting intensity is measured in lux. The recommended lux levels for manufacturing floor areas can range from 300 to 1,000, depending on the tasks being conducted. For precise tasks, levels should be on the higher end. However, achieving these lux requirements is not always straightforward. Many factories face challenges, such as outdated lighting systems or inadequate maintenance, which can result in inconsistent light distribution.

It’s crucial to measure light levels accurately. Use a light meter to check if your factory meets the minimum lux standards. Different areas may require different lux levels. Ensure workstations, walkways, and emergency exits are well-lit. Regularly schedule assessments to identify any deficiencies.
Investing in LED lighting can improve clarity without excessive energy costs. Position lights strategically to eliminate shadows and dark spots.
